Margaret Hogan Strailman (1904 - 1984) Brunswick Distinguished CitizenDistinguished Citizen 1984.
From the Brunswick: 100 Years of Memories: Margaret Ellen hogan graduated from Towson State Normal School in 1924 with a teaching certificate. She taught first grade for 50 years at East Brunswick School and Brunswick Elementary. During this time, Margaret earned credits and received her BA Degree from Shepherd College. For over 60 years she served Bethany Lutheran Church in Brunswick as organist.
